Legal Victory: Tax Tribunal Strikes Down Unsubstantiated Income Additions, Upholds Taxpayer Rights Under Section 69

ITAT allowed the appeal, setting aside the CIT(A)'s order and deleting additions under Section 69. The tribunal found critical procedural and evidentiary defects in the assessment order, specifically noting that the Assessing Officer (AO) relied solely on an incomplete statement without seeking explanations from directors, failed to establish concrete evidence of unaccounted investments, and improperly concluded deposits were made by directors based on minor clerical errors in forms. The tribunal emphasized that the burden of proof lies with the revenue authority, which failed to substantiate allegations of undisclosed investments made by the assessee. The order was decided in favor of the assessee, effectively quashing the disputed tax additions.
